text: San Gerónimo Airport is an airstrip serving Algarrobo, a Pacific coastal city in the Valparaíso Region of Chile. The airstrip is 4.6 kilometres (2.9 mi) inland from the coast. The runway parallels an east–west road atop a low ridge. There are ravines to the north and south of the runway. Another road intersects the runway at a shallow angle, giving the runway the visual appearance of being bent. The Santo Domingo VOR-DME is located 18.8 nautical miles (34.8 km) south of San Gerónimo Airport
